<div role="main"><h1>Converting CDT 1.x Projects</h1>

<p>How you update your CDT 1.x project to the current CDT project format depends upon whether the 
project is a Standard Make project or a Managed Make project. For a Standard 
Make project, see <strong>Convert to C/C++ Project Wizard</strong> below.</p>
<h2>Updating a Managed Make Project </h2>

<p>For a Managed Make project, the Managed Build system will prompt you to 
convert your project when it attempts to read the Managed Build project 
information and discovers that the project needs to be updated.&nbsp; You will be prompted to update the project.</p>
<p> <img src="../images/update_managed_build.png" alt="Update Managed Builder dialog box"></p>
<p>Click <strong>Yes</strong> and the project will be updated.&nbsp; The updated Managed 
Build information can no longer be loaded by CDT 1.x or CDT 2.x.&nbsp; Select <strong>
No</strong> and the project will not be updated.&nbsp; You will be able to view the 
Managed Build settings, but no changes will be saved when you close the project 
or exit Eclipse.</p>

<h2>Convert to a C/C++ Project Wizard</h2>

<p>Select <strong>File > New > Convert to a C/C++ Project</strong>. If that selection is not available, you can find the instructions for adding it <a href="cdt_t_add_custom_persp.htm">here</a>.</p>
<p><img src="../images/file_new_conv.png" alt="File - New - Convert to a C/C++ Project menu selection"></p>
 
<p>From the <strong>Convert to C/C++ Make Project Wizard</strong> select the project you want to convert and click <strong>Finish</strong>.</p>
<p><img src="../images/convert_proj.png" alt="Convert to C/C++ Project Wizard"></p>

<p><strong>Note: </strong>You may need to manually enable Path Discovery for CDT 1.x Standard Make projects, depending on how your CDT project was configured.  
See <a href="cdt_t_discovery.htm">Set Discovery Options</a> for details.</p>
